Analysis

Cameroon recorded 33.2% for perc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are qualified in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 5 years on record.

That represents a change of down 23.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are qualified in Cameroon peaked at 44.2% in 2016 and was at its lowest, 33.2%, in 2023.

That places Cameroon 49th out of 57 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
